About SEMA

For four decades SEMA, the Specialty Equipment Market Association, has been at the forefront of the automotive aftermarket – a unique industry dedicated to the enhanced performance, appearance and handling of all types of passenger cars, light trucks and recreational vehicles.

Now more than 5,200 companies strong, SEMA has evolved into an international trade association, which today serves and embraces a diverse constituency representing the full spectrum of the specialty automotive equipment industry.

From performance products for street and race applications to appearance accessories for late-model automobiles, SEMA-member companies contribute to the vitality and strength of a $29 billion-a-year retail industry. Cosmetic accessories and handling equipment for the booming sport compact market, along with parts and accessories for muscle cars, classics, street rods and light trucks are all part of this industry.
